My bio for the Milblog convention

Sean Dustman is the author of the blog Doc in the Box and has been writing on the blog since January 2004. He is a native of Prescott Valley Arizona and has 13 years on his Navy clock with a small 3 year break till right after the attacks of 9/11 when he felt his talents in medicine were being wasted working on cars. Currently stationed at MCAS Miramar, he is the squadron corpsman for HMH-462 and just returned from his third trip to Iraq last fall.

He started reading blogs in early 2003 with Salam Pax, Lt Smash, turningtables, Sgt Hook, Chief Wiggles and started a photo blog following in these large footsteps. Eventually peer pressure sank in to open up a “respectable” blog which he dubbed “Doc in the Box”. Over the years since, his multitasking with the two sites increased over into myspaceland, youtube, castpost and nameless others until he now has a vast online networking portfolio can sometimes be a huge hassle if he thinks too much on the subject. He takes great pride in the amount of information he has been able to put out without having to pay a cent. He considers his blogs politically neutral and pro-military.

His vital stats, married to a lovely girl who happens to have pink hair, father of a 13 year old son and a shelter dog named Gatsby. He has worked successfully as a mechanic, landscaper, corpsman, photographer, cook and framer and would eventually like to find a job that uses his various talents. Military achievements include The 2002 Chief Hospital Corpsman George William “Doc” Piercy Award presented personally by Commandant of the Marine Corps, General James Jones at the Marine Expo in Quantico VA, 2 Navy Achievement Medals and 3 Good conduct awards
